Abstract :
The nature of warfare has changed dramatically since the September 11 event, and military RF systems should change accordingly. This demand poses a challenge and also an opportunity for MicroWave Photonics (MWP) technology. We will examine the insertion potential of MWP to RF systems using a top-down approach, where the changes are analyzed and the flow down requirements for the RF system are discussed against the MWP capabilities. It is found that although MWP faces stiff competition from digital technology, it can find niche applications where only photonics can provide solutions.
